What are the best practices for purchasing bitcoins safely?

I want to purchase bitcoins but I'm concerned about the safety of the process. What are the best practices I should follow to ensure a safe purchase?

    When purchasing bitcoins, it's important to prioritize safety. Here are some best practices to follow: 1. Use a reputable exchange: Choose a well-established and regulated exchange to ensure the security of your funds. 2. Enable two-factor authentication (2FA): Add an extra layer of security by enabling 2FA on your exchange account. 3. Use a hardware wallet: Consider storing your bitcoins in a hardware wallet, which provides offline storage and added security. 4. Research the seller: If purchasing bitcoins from an individual, research their reputation and history to ensure they are trustworthy. 5. Be cautious of phishing attempts: Be vigilant for phishing emails or websites that may try to steal your login credentials. Remember, safety should always be a top priority when purchasing bitcoins.
